China's Pro-Natalist Campaign: A Controversial Turn
This chapter examines China's bold campaign targeting young married women to increase the plummeting birth rate, which has fallen to 1.1 births per woman. It investigates the government's invasive methods, the cultural shifts surrounding family values, and the challenges faced in reversing demographic trends following the one-child policy. Through personal anecdotes and expert insights, the chapter highlights the tension between state initiatives and individual autonomy in responding to reproductive policies.
